A super quick and easy sauce to pour over raw cucumber or zucchini pasta
-
Rating
5/5 (from 1 ratings)5 -
Yield
Enough to pour over two servings of pasta
Found in:
Ingredients
2 Tomatoes, Chopped
1 Clove Garlic, Chopped
Small slice of jalapeno, chopped
2 basil leaves
dash of sea salt
Recipe Directions
Take all ingredients, and process in food processer. Then you have a quick, easy marinara sauce, ready for your pasta. This can also be eaten as a tomato soup!!
